Agnes Martin (1912-2004) – Canada-born American Artist
Suite for the deluxe edition of the catalog for the exhibition of the artist at Stedelijk Museum Amsterdam, Museum Wiesbaden, Westfälisches Museum für Kunst und Kulturgeschichte, Münster and Musée d’Art Moderne de la Ville de Paris, 1991/1992
Edition of 2500
Printed by Nemela & Lenzen, Mönchengladbach
Published by Stedelijk Museum, Amsterdam
Together with the exhibition catalog and a supplementary text booklet for the award of the Jawlensky prize in cardboard wrapper
Image dimensions of the prints: 22.8 x 22.8 cm; sheet dimensions of the prints: 30 x 30 cm
Overall dimensions: 30.5 x 30.5 x 2 cm
Provenance: Private collection, Southwest Germany
The transparency of the paper underlines the delicate beauty of the reproduced compositions
Condition:
All 10 reproductions are in overall very good condition. The firm transparency paper is minor toned. Catalog and booklet are in good condition with only insignificant signs of use. The wrapper out of firm cardboard displays a short tear (c. 2 cm) and occasional small scuffing to the corners and edges.
Agnes Martin (1912-2004)
Agnes Martin was born in Canada. In 1931 she moved to the USA, where she studied and taught. Her first solo exhibition at the Betty Parsons Gallery in New York in 1957 made her famous in the art world. Her highly reduced works, geometrically arranged with fine lines, grit structures and delicate colors aim for expressing essential emotions such as happiness, love, harmony in a kind of absolute painting, thus representing a combination of Minimal Art and Abstract Expressionism. The artist took part in the documenta exhibitions 5 and 6 in 1972 and 1977. Also in 2007 works by her were shown at documenta 12. In addition, there are works in prestigious museums such as the Guggenheim Collection and the Museum of Modern Art in New York, the Tate Gallery, London, and the K20 in Düsseldorf. (fea)
